Managing Mercury Inhalation Effects in the Workplace

Mercury Inhalation Effects in the Workplace

Mercury is a potent neurotoxin that can pose serious health risks when inhaled in the workplace. Exposure to mercury vapor primarily occurs in industries such as dentistry, mining, and manufacturing, where mercury is used in various forms. Understanding and managing the effects of mercury inhalation is crucial for ensuring employee safety and regulatory compliance.

Health Risks:
Mercury vapor can be absorbed through the lungs and subsequently impact the nervous system, kidneys, and respiratory system. Symptoms of mercury inhalation effects may include memory loss, mood swings, tremors, and respiratory distress. Prolonged exposure can lead to chronic mercury poisoning, which can be debilitating or even fatal.

Preventive Measures:
Employers must implement strict safety measures to mitigate mercury inhalation risks. This includes providing appropriate personal protective equipment (PPE) like respirators and ensuring proper ventilation in areas where mercury is used. Regular monitoring of air quality for mercury levels is essential.

Training and Education:
Employees should receive comprehensive training on the hazards of mercury inhalation and how to use protective equipment correctly. They should also be educated on the importance of personal hygiene practices, such as handwashing, to minimize the risk of mercury contamination.

Regulatory Compliance:
Adherence to local and national regulations concerning mercury exposure is mandatory. Employers must keep abreast of changing guidelines and standards to maintain a safe workplace.

Emergency Response:
Establishing emergency response protocols is essential. In the event of mercury exposure, immediate medical attention is critical. Employees should know how to seek medical assistance promptly.
